BROADLANDS – Kyndrie Carter and Sophie Monts led the Arthur Lovington Atwood Hammond softball team to a 16-10 Lincoln Prairie Conference win over Heritage, which also snapped a four-game losing streak.
It is the senior trip for ALAH this week and so they don’t play again until Monday at Neoga in a non-conference game.
On April 28 Villa Grove scored 13 runs in the first inning and went on to down ALAH 14-4 in five innings, while Thursday the Knights lost another LPC game, falling to Argenta-Oreana 12-7. ALAH led 6-4 after three innings, but only scored one more run in the final four innings, while the Bombers scored at least one run in the final four innings to win 12-7. Annabelle Vanausdoll was 4-for-4 and Anna Rawlins 3-for-3 in the loss.
Arthur Lovington Atwood Hammond at Heritage, Friday
ALAH got off to a strong start and it looked like they would win the game in five innings as they sent 12 batters to the plate and scored eight runs. However, Heritage answered with a seven-run first of its own and tied the game with a run in the second. The Hawks took the lead with two runs in the third for a 10-8 advantage. The Knights got one run back in the fourth and the score remained 10-9 until the top of the sixth.
ALAH took the lead for good in the sixth when Sophie Monts was hit by a pitch and stole second and eventually scored. With two outs London Dugan singled to center and Claire Sass, who was a courtesy runner for Dugan, scored on a double by Annie Ponder for the 11-10 lead.
ALAH tacked on some insurance runs in the seventh starting with a triple by Reece Oye, who scored on a ground out. Annabelle Vanasudoll doubled and scored on an error, the only one of the game by either team. Monts doubled to left and went to third on a single by Rawlins. Carter drove both runners in with a double for a 15–10 lead and a double by Dugan scored Rawlins for the final margin of six runs.
Carter, the winning pitcher, was 3-for-5 with four RBIs, while Monts was 4-for-4 with two RBIs and Dugan and Annabelle Vanausdoll were 3-for-5 with an RBI, while Reece Oye was 3-for-4 with a RBI.
The Knights moved to 8-16 overall and 4-4 in the LPC, good for fifth place in the 10-team conference, while Heritage dropped to 0-13 overall and 0-5 in the LPC.
